Selecting Sedge Species for Corridor Gardens
Selecting sedge species for corridor gardens enhances habitat connectivity by supporting diverse wildlife and promoting ecosystem stability. Native sedges such as Carex stricta, Carex flacca, and Carex rostrata offer robust root systems that prevent soil erosion and provide cover for small mammals and insects. Incorporating a variety of sedge species tailored to local soil moisture and light conditions ensures optimal growth and maximizes biodiversity benefits within habitat corridors.

Complementary Plant Pairings with Sedges
Sedge patches thrive when paired with complementary plants such as native rushes and wildflowers, enhancing biodiversity and soil stability. These combinations support diverse wildlife by providing layered habitats and continuous food sources throughout the growing season. Incorporating species like Carex with flowering plants such as Lobelia cardinalis promotes resilient ecosystems within habitat corridors.
